Cecil Fletcher
Cecil Fletcher
  • Induction:
    2013
  • Class:
    1987
An All-Southern Conference defensive lineman, Cecil Fletcher helped Marshall advance to its first NCAA Division I-AA national championship game in 1987. One of the most disruptive pass rushers to don the Green and White, Fletcher set a school record with 19 tackles for loss, including 17 quarterback sacks, during the 1986 season. His 4 ½ sacks in a win at Ohio University that season remain the Marshall single-game record. The Bloomington, Ohio, native was selected to play in the East-West Shrine Game following his senior season, which made him the first Marshall student-athlete to participate in a postseason all-star game since Jackie Hunt in 1942. Fletcher was inducted into the Marshall Athletic Hall of Fame in 2013.
